Statements : All oranges are apples. No
apple is a grape. Conclusions : I. No orange is a grape. II. All apples are oranges. In each question below are given some statements followed by two conclusions numbered I and II are given. You have to take the given statements to be true even if they seem to be at variance with commonly known facts and then decide which of the given conclusions logically follows from the given statements, disregarding commonly known facts.Solution
All oranges are apples (A) + No apple is a grape (E) β No orange is a grape (E). Hence conclusion I follows. All oranges are apples (A) β Conversion β Some apples are not oranges (O). Hence conclusion II does not follow.
